The Fine Line Between Victory and Disqualification in NASCAR

In the high-stakes world of NASCAR, where every inch matters, a recent event at Rockingham Speedway highlights the delicate balance between triumph and heartbreak. Corey Heim, behind the wheel of the #1 Robinhood Toyota, emerged victorious in the NASCAR Craftsman Truck Series Black's Tire 200, leaving his competitors in the dust. But the story doesn't end there, as a crucial post-race inspection twist changes the narrative.

One of the most intriguing aspects of NASCAR is the meticulous attention to detail in post-race inspections. These inspections ensure fair play and maintain the integrity of the sport. In this case, the #38-Chandler Smith truck failed to meet the rear body inspection height requirements, leading to a disqualification. It's a stark reminder that victory is not just about crossing the finish line first but also about adhering to the stringent rules of the game.
